Most house owners start with item inquiries. Which panel is finest? Is one inverter brand better than an additional? Must I add a battery currently or later?
Those are fair inquiries, yet they follow the larger concern: system style and implementation. A premium panel mounted on the wrong roofing plane or paired with careless electrical wiring is not a premium system. On the other hand, a mid to top tier panel with audio design work, appropriate setbacks, precise shading evaluation, and a receptive service team usually executes specifically as it needs to for years.
Solar is not a single acquisition. It is a series of choices. Site assessment, design, funding, contract language, allows, installation, evaluation, PTO from the energy, and future solution all influence the last value. The installer touches every step.
That is why the most inexpensive quote is not always the least pricey alternative in method. A lower proposal can hide weaker assumptions regarding yearly production, unrealistic scheduling, or thin post-install assistance. If a firm vanishes, subcontracts everything without oversight, or drags out improvement job, the financial savings vanish quickly.
Solar propositions ought to never ever look identical from residence to residence. Danville residential or commercial properties frequently differ in roof covering pitch, mature landscaping, building style, and available southern, southwest, or west-facing roof covering room. Some homes have broad warm sections that make solar straightforward. Others have dormers, smokeshafts, vents, or tree shading that force tighter style choices.
That is where skilled regional judgment shows up. A solid installer can inform you when a roofing is solar-friendly, when trimming trees would materially enhance outcome, and when the very best financial action is to set up fewer panels in better settings as opposed to loading every readily available surface.
Local code and energy procedures likewise matter. The specific timeline for approval depends on license evaluation, examination organizing, and utility interconnection requirements. Installers who frequently work in the location typically recognize those steps far better than a remote sales operation that deals with every city the exact same. A good proposal really feels certain. It must reflect your house, your electrical use, and your objectives. If it reviews like a common design template with your address pasted in, that is a warning sign.
At a minimum, the proposition needs to discuss the number of panels are being mounted, where they are going, what tools is included, what estimated manufacturing looks like, and what presumptions drive the savings projection. If there is funding, the installer needs to separate system price from funding cost so you can see what you are actually spending for the equipment and labor.
The much better propositions also resolve what takes place if problems change. As an example, if the roof covering outdoor decking demands repair service after panel removal locations are exposed, who deals with that? If the primary circuit box needs upgrades to support solar, is that consisted of or detailed as an allocation? If a battery is not included now, can the system fit one later on without nearby solar installation companies major redesign?
A proposition worth trusting typically appears a little much less fancy and a bit a lot more concrete. That is an excellent thing.

This difference catches several house owners unsuspecting. Some businesses are largely marketing and sales companies. They create leads, close contracts, and afterwards hand the actual job to another company for design or setup. That model is not instantly negative, yet it includes intricacy. When something fails, you may locate yourself jumping in between parties.
An installation-led firm is usually much easier to take care of because design, permitting, field job, and solution are under one roof covering or under tighter functional control. That does not assure quality, but it often boosts accountability. If the team harms a floor tile, routes conduit awkwardly, or requires a quick design change, the interaction loop is shorter.
When comparing solar setup Danville providers, ask directly who will certainly be responsible for each stage of the task. You want clarity on who offered the system, who engineered it, who will certainly install it, and who responds to the phone if there is an issue a year later.
Homeowners not surprisingly focus on the overall contract cost. They should. Solar is a major acquisition. Still, raw price alone can be misleading.
Two systems with similar panel counts might vary since one includes a primary panel upgrade, attic room channel runs, critter guard, keeping track of arrangement, and more powerful handiwork protection. Another might look cheaper since crucial things are left out or because the financing structure spreads prices in a manner that hides the actual system price.
Cash purchases, car loans, leases, and power acquisition contracts all transform how value must be judged. A low regular monthly payment can be achieved by extending term length or embedding costs into financing. That does not make it an inadequate alternative for every house owner, but it does indicate you should compare equal numbers.
A beneficial method to evaluate proposals is to ask each business to offer the money rate, funding terms, estimated first-year manufacturing, and what is consisted of in composing. When those numbers are on the table, contrasts end up being a lot more honest.
If your roof covering is near the end of its life, solar might need to wait. I recognize property owners do not enjoy hearing that, especially after hanging around on price quotes, yet eliminating and re-installing a solar variety later on is costly and disruptive.
A responsible installer will certainly not hurry past this point. They will certainly evaluate roof covering age, material, and noticeable problem. On asphalt roof shingles roofings, if you are within a number of years of replacement, it is worth going over roof covering initially. On ceramic tile roofing systems, the conversation might change toward underlayment problem, delicacy, and the skill of staffs working around ceramic tile. On complicated roof coverings with multiple penetrations, flashing quality ends up being even more important.
This is where depend on shows up again. Good installers agree to lose a sale today to prevent a negative task tomorrow. That sincerity often tends to save homeowners money.
Storage has ended up being a much bigger component of the solar discussion, and for good factor. Some homeowners desire backup power for blackouts. Others desire more control over how they make use of solar energy, especially if utility rate frameworks make self-consumption more valuable.
Still, a battery is not automatically the right add-on. It enhances project cost substantially, and not every household requires full-home back-up. Often a partial back-up approach covering refrigeration, net, some illumination, and a few circuits is the better fit. Occasionally property owners select solar currently and leave the system battery-ready for later.
A good installer need to stroll you with real usage instances. If your main worry is keeping clinical equipment, garage accessibility, and food refrigeration online throughout interruptions, that is a different battery style than trying to run air conditioning for extensive durations. System sizing must follow your needs, not the various other method around.

Solar guarantee language is often misinterpreted. Devices service warranties typically come from the supplier. Handiwork guarantees come from the installer. Roofing system penetration guarantees might be individually stated. Those differences matter because the process for obtaining assistance depends upon who is responsible.
Ask who you call initially if output drops unexpectedly. Ask what service action looks like. Ask whether labor for warranty replacements is covered. Ask how surveillance signals are dealt with, and whether somebody is really examining them or if the burden drops completely on you.
The practical test is easy: if an inverter fails 6 years from now, will you understand specifically who to call, and do you think they will still exist? Strong neighborhood firms usually win on this point, also if they are not the most inexpensive quote. Integrity after installation has genuine value.
A solar selection should fit the household, not an abstract average. Past energy costs matter, yet future adjustments matter too. If a family members anticipates to include an electric automobile, switch to a heat pump, mount a pool heater, or create a home office, existing use might downplay future demand.
Likewise, oversized systems are not always the response. Depending upon regional energy rules, overproducing far past yearly use might not offer in proportion financial return. This is an additional area where experienced modeling issues. The most effective solar installment firms near me will certainly not simply try to maximize panel count. They will chat with use patterns, budget plan, and anticipated repayment in reasonable terms.
A great sizing discussion needs to really feel specific to your household. If it does not, the proposal is most likely as well generic.
Many home owners believe setup day is the main event. It is very important, however it is only one action. A project can relocate swiftly on the roofing system and after that sit in a line for inspection or utility authorization. That is irritating if nobody discussed the procedure upfront.
Competent installers set assumptions early. They will normally describe the series in simple language: layout finalization, permit submission, setup scheduling, community examination, utility approval, and authorization to operate. They may not have the ability to ensure exact days, due to the fact that some actions rely on agencies outside their control, however they ought to have the ability to describe the most likely rhythm of the job.
That type of communication is especially important if you are intending around travel, roof substitute, refinance timing, or a major household task. The difference between a three-week hold-up and a three-month surprise frequently boils down to exactly how proactive the installer is.

Yes, solar panels continue producing electricity during winter whenever sunlight is available. Shorter days and cloud cover usually reduce total energy production compared to summer. Cold temperatures can improve panel efficiency under clear conditions. Keeping panels free of debris helps maintain performance.
